INGENIERIA DE SOFTWARE 3ER PARCIAL GRUPO
EXAMEN TERCER PARCIAL
INGENIERÍA DE SOFTWARE
VERSIÓN A.
NOMBRE:
FECHA:
I.
SEMESTRE:
MAESTRO:
CARRERA:
INSTRUCCIONES: Realizar el proceso deUML y herramientas CASE.
Se desea diseñar el software para una un restaurante, el cual se encargara de operaciones como cobrar, indicar mesas
ocupadas,facturación electrónica y checada del personal. Este sistema se instalara en un servidor, la cual estará en red
con una pc ubicada en la caja. El restauranteaceptara pago de efectivo como de tarjeta de crédito. El sistema llevara el
registro de las transacciones efectuadas, cumpliendo con característicasaceptables de seguridad.
También se llevara el registro del personal quien cumple con su horario de entrega, y las que tengan más de 3 retardos
se le descontara 1día y no trabajara ese día. Por último, en las mesas ocupadas solamente al momento de que llegue el
cliente, se le asignara en el sistema la mesa, tambiéndeberá de tener la opción de cambiar de mesa en el sistema si el
cliente realiza esa acción.
a) Realizar la notación UML de un sistema de punto de venta de unrestaurante:
a. Diagrama de casos de uso.
b. Diagrama de actividad.
c. Diagrama de clases.
d. Diagrama de estado.
e. Diagrama de secuencia.
f. Diagrama decolaboración.
g. Diagrama de componentes.
Y realizarlo en un lenguaje de programación UML.
b) En el mismo proyecto, explicar que herramientas case utilizaríasen todo el ciclo de vida del proyecto.
Nota: Entregar la actividad por correo electrónico, tanto los diagramas del punto a, la explicación del punto b.
Regístrate para leer el documento completo.